A first look at Hulu orginial movie “Summer of 69” starring Chloe Fineman, Nicole Byer, and more

Summer of 69 is set to premiere May 9 on Hulu.

Hulu has shared a first look at its orginial film “Summer of 69” set to premiere May 9 on the streaming platform.

Marking Jillian Bell’s feature directorial debut and starring Chloe Fineman, Nicole Byer, Sam Morelos, Matt Cornett, Liza Koshy, and more.

Synopsis

An awkward high school senior hires an exotic dancer to help seduce her longtime crush before graduation, leading to unexpected friendship and lessons in self-confidence, acceptance and adulthood.

CAST

The film stars Chloe Fineman, Sam Morelos, Matt Cornett, Nicole Byer, Liza Koshy, Natalie Morales, Alex Moffat, Fernando Carsa, Paula Pell and Charlie Day.

Credits

“Summer of 69” is directed by Jillian Bell, who also co-wrote the screenplay alongside Liz Nico and Jules Byrne. The film is produced by Jeremy Garelick, Will Phelps, Molle DeBartolo, Jillian Bell, Breanna Bell-Singer, Matt Skiena, Adam Goodman and Lucas Carter .
